Robustness Analysis of Watermarking Schemes Based on Two Novel Transforms

In this paper, two novel transforms are defined, which are respectively called DWT-IDCT transform and DCT-IDWT transform, and then two novel watermarking schemes based on these two transforms are proposed. The proposed schemes are compared with the existing scheme based on DWT transform. Furthermore, since the defined transforms can be roundly used, the schemes themselves are compared in order to evaluate the effect of the round time to the schemes. As is shown by the comparison and analysis, the scheme based on DCT-IDWT is the most robust against the various attacks than the others, and moreover, the round time is chosen once or twice as recommendation for the consideration of robustness and computation time.
